Nanosilica refers to an allotrope of silicon that contains 99% silicon dioxide. It is used to reduce cement volume while optimizing the grading of the aggregate mix in the smallest size range. Silicon is the second most abundant element in the Earth's crust.
The nanosilica market, covered in this report, is segmented by type into P type, S type, and type III. It is also segmented by raw material into rice husk, olivine, bagasse, and others. Furthermore, it is segmented by application into rubber, health and medicine, food, coatings, plastic, concrete, gypsum, cosmetics, electronics, and others.

The nanosilica market size has grown strongly in recent years. It will grow from $4.36 billion in 2024 to $4.65 billion in 2025 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.7%. The growth in the historic period can be attributed to increasing demand for nanotechnology applications in electronics, growing use of nanosilica inThe construction industry, rise in demand for nanosilica inThe healthcare sector for drug delivery systems, stringent environmental regulations, adoption of eco-friendly nanomaterials.
The nanosilica market size is expected to see strong growth in the next few years. It will grow to $6.39 billion in 2029 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 8.3%. The growth in the forecast period can be attributed to expansion of the automotive industry, growing demand for high-performance coatings in various industries, rise in research and development activities, increasing awareness and adoption of nanosilica in the energy sector, surge in demand for nanosilica in water treatment applications. The surge in demand for nanoparticles in the medical sector has been a significant factor contributing to the growth of the nano-silica market. Nanoparticles are increasingly employed in diverse medical applications, including imaging, sensing, targeted drug delivery, gene delivery systems, and artificial implants. Notably, a recent study conducted by the George Washington (GW) Cancer Center highlighted the promise of nanoparticle-encapsulated doxorubicin in treating triple-negative breast carcinoma. This anthracycline drug, when encapsulated in amino-functionalized silica nanoparticles (SiNPs), proves effective in targeted drug delivery for potential carcinoma treatment. SiNPs can efficiently encapsulate doxorubicin and be coupled with a targeting moiety like anti-Claudin-4 (CLN4). Nanoparticles have shown utility in enhancing ultrasound imaging contrast, particularly in tumor imaging. The robust demand from the medical sector is expected to drive substantial revenue growth for the nano-silica market.
The burgeoning automobile industry is anticipated to be a driving force behind the nanosilica market's growth in the foreseeable future. The automotive sector, comprising businesses involved in designing, developing, manufacturing, marketing, and selling automobiles, extensively utilizes nanosilica in coatings, tires, and interior components. Nanosilica's unique properties, including enhancing material strength and durability, reducing friction and wear, improving fuel efficiency, and providing UV protection and scratch resistance, make it valuable in automobile manufacturing. For instance, in January 2023, the Federal Chamber of Automotive Industries reported robust automobile demand in Australia during 2022, with 1,081,429 automobiles delivered, where light commercial vehicles and SUVs constituted 76. 8% of total sales. Consequently, the expanding automobile industry serves as a key driver for the nanosilica market.
Major companies operating in the nanosilica market are focusing on developing innovative products, such as nanoparticle-coated cotton fabric, to better meet the needs of their existing consumers. Cotton fabric treated with silica nanoparticles enhances the material with microscopic silica particles for improved durability, stain resistance, and moisture management. For instance, in September 2023, the Indian Institute of Technology (IIT) Guwahati, a public technical university in India, developed cotton fabric treated with silica nanoparticles that can effectively remove oil from oil-water mixtures. This research project aims to convert large amounts of agricultural waste into an environmentally friendly, value-added product to help mitigate marine oil pollution. The nanoparticles used in this project were synthesized from rice husk, an agricultural byproduct, serving as the principal raw material. The findings of this study may pave the way for constructing cost-effective, long-term solutions for separating oil/water mixtures or hazardous components from marine environments. This innovation reflects the growing trend of utilizing nanosilica in textile applications to address pressing environmental challenges.
